Compliance and Regulatory Issues
Delinquency Notification Letter
On March 19, 2024, The Joint Corp. announced that it had received a delinquency notification letter from the Nasdaq Stock Market. This letter, as detailed in the company’s official press release, indicated that The Joint Corp. was not in compliance with Nasdaq’s continued listing requirements due to a delay in filing its annual report. Such notifications can have significant implications for a publicly traded company, including potential delisting and loss of investor confidence.
Failure to comply with financial reporting requirements can also trigger regulatory investigations and shareholder lawsuits. For The Joint Corp., timely resolution of these issues is critical to maintaining its market position and credibility with investors.
Regulatory Scrutiny in Chiropractic Practice
The chiropractic industry as a whole has faced increased regulatory attention. For example, the U.S. Department of Justice has previously taken action against chiropractic organizations for anticompetitive practices, as seen in the settlement with Chiropractic Associates Ltd. of South Dakota. While this case did not involve The Joint Corp. directly, it highlights the regulatory risks that all chiropractic providers must manage.

Privacy Violations and Patient Safety
The Hidden Camera Incident
A particularly serious legal and reputational issue for The Joint Corp. arose from allegations against Dr. Nicholas Vanderhyde, a chiropractor associated with one of its clinics. According to a report by the Sacramento Bee, Dr. Vanderhyde was accused of hiding a camera to record patients, including minors, at a Santa Clarita facility.
This incident led to multiple lawsuits, including one where 17 patients filed suit after discovering the hidden camera. The lawsuits allege serious violations of patient privacy and raise questions about The Joint Corp.’s oversight and risk management practices.
Legal and Reputational Implications
Privacy violations in healthcare settings are subject to strict legal penalties under state and federal law, including the Health Insurance Portability and Accountability Act (HIPAA). While individual practitioners may be directly responsible, companies like The Joint Corp. can also face liability for failing to implement adequate safeguards or for negligent hiring and supervision.
Beyond legal liability, incidents like the hidden camera case can severely damage a company’s reputation. They may lead to loss of patient trust, negative media coverage, and increased regulatory scrutiny.

Historical and Broader Legal Context
Wilk v. American Medical Association
The legal environment for chiropractic practices has evolved significantly over the past few decades. A landmark case, Wilk v. American Medical Association, challenged antitrust practices that restricted chiropractors’ access to hospitals and professional legitimacy. While not directly related to The Joint Corp., this case illustrates the broader legal context in which chiropractic providers operate.
